UEFA partners with Vodafone

The Union of European Football Associations (UEFA), the official governing body of football in Europe, has announced a multi-year partnership with Vodafone.

The British telecom operator has been confirmed as the official telecommunications partner of UEFA Women’s Football on a five-year deal. covering the following tournaments: the UEFA Women’s Champions League, UEFA Women’s Futsal EURO 2027, UEFA Women’s EURO 2029, the UEFA Women’s Nations League, the Women’s European Qualifiers, as well as the UEFA Women’s Under-17 and Under-19 Championships.

As far as men’s football is concerned, Vodafone has also been named an official licensed partner of the UEFA Champions League for its 2025/26 and 2026/27 editions. To kick off the partnership, Vodafone has launched the “Champions Travel eSIM”, which will offer customers connectivity in 206 countries, as well as “the opportunity to win free match tickets via periodic draws.”

Vodafone previously sponsored the UEFA Champions League from 2006 to 2009.

Nadine Kessler, General Manager of UEFA Women’s Football, commented:

The meteoric rise of women’s football is undeniable, confirmed by the record-breaking success of this summer’s UEFA European Women’s Football Championship. The sport continues to attract some of the world’s best-known companies eager to be part of this memorable experience. We are delighted to welcome Vodafone to the community of UEFA Women’s competitions partners. Their commitment and global reach makes them an ideal ally in our joint efforts to take the sport forward. In doing so, we will pave the way to more opportunities for women and girls and inspire the next generation of fans and players around the world.

Ahmed Essam, CEO European Markets, Vodafone Group, added:

It is great to be associated with European football once again. We are delighted to sponsor women’s football, one of the fastest growing sports globally. Also, as an official licensed partner of the world’s premier men’s club competition, Vodafone will help enhance the fan experience.
